Victorious In Varna

Courtesy of WOWSA, Black Sea, Bulgaria.

Bulgaria’s Black Sea city of Varna has hosted the 4.5 km Varna-Galata Swimming Marathon (Плувен маратон Галата-Варна) for the 78th time.

Cash prizes of 1,000BGN (US$591) are given to the top finishers that included Ventseslav Aidarski last year who won in 52 minutes 55 seconds, a record time. Gabriela Georgieva set the women’s record of 54 minutes 32 seconds.

This year, International Marathon Swimming Hall of Fame inductee Vojislav Mijić of Serbia will also participate in his 7th edition [shown on left].
